#b1fba8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b1fba8 is composed of 69.4% red, 98.4% green and 65.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 33.1%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 113.5 degrees, a saturation of 91.2% and a lightness of 82.2%. #b1fba8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#63f751. Closest websafe color is: #99ff99.

#b1fba8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b1fba8 has RGB values of R:177, G:251, B:168 and CMYK values of C:0.29, M:0, Y:0.33,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 11664296.

Shades and Tints of #b1fba8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010700 is the darkest color, while #f4fef3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b1fba8
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#cfd5cf is the less saturated color, while #aeffa5 is the most saturated one.
